Today I went to Kirkville, NY. Here are some of my pictures of this falls. It's on private property and you need permission.
It's about 15 feet wide and 27 feet tall. As you can see the water was flowing good. It's supplied by a swamp above. The owner told me that years ago, there was a mill above falls and the swamp was a pond. He plans on making the pond again in future. The only thing left of mill is two concrete blocks at the top.
Here is the location of this falls: N 43.06676 W 75.93274 .
